一、cat命令
1、cat用来查看文件内容
2、cat -n:将输出的内容进行编号(空格也给编号)
[root@sc-chenlu lianxi]# cat -n passwd
1 root:x:0:0:root:/root:/bin/bash
2 bin:x:1:1:bin:/bin:/sbin/nologin
3 daemon:x:2:2:daemon:/sbin:/sbin/nologin
4 adm:x:3:4:adm:/var/adm:/sbin/nologin
5 lp:x:4:7:lp:/var/spool/lpd:/sbin/nologin
6 sync:x:5:0:sync:/sbin:/bin/sync
3,nl --将输出的内容编号(空行不给编号)
[root@sc-chenlu lianxi]# nl hosts
1 127.0.0.1 localhost localhost.localdomain localhost4 localhost4.localdomain4
2 ::1 localhost localhost.localdomain localhost6 localhost6.localdomain6
4、more和less查看文件内容:
less可以按键盘上下方向键显示上下内容
more不能通过上下方向键控制显示
less退出后shell不会留下刚显示的内容,而more退出后会在shell上留下刚显示的内容.
5、tail和head:
tail和head默认查看文本的最后和开头10行
指定行数噢(查看文件开头25行):
head -n 25 +文件名
head -25 +文件名
当你不知道某个命令的用法时可以使用man命令,例如man tail--可以知道tail的具体用法
6、| 管道符号: 将前面命令的输出送给后面的命令作为输入 借花献佛,中间人
grep 是文本过滤命令,默认情况下符合要求(匹配的)会整行显示出来
grep经常与wc搭配使用(wc是一个统计命令统计行,单词,字节wc 是一个统计命令,统计行,单词,字节 (man wc 可以查看wc的用法)
wc - print newline, word, and byte counts for each file
-w, --words
print the word counts
-l, --lines
print the newline counts)